Benefits of Quality Pet Food
As responsible pet owners, one of the most crucial decisions we face is selecting the right food for our beloved animals. The choice to provide high-quality pet food goes beyond mere sustenance; it directly influences the overall health and well-being of our pets.
-
Enhanced Nutritional Value for Optimal Health Quality pet food is meticulously crafted to provide a balanced blend of essential nutrients vital for your pet's well-being. From proteins to vitamins and minerals, these formulations ensure that your pet receives the necessary building blocks for a healthy life.
-
Digestive Health and Nutrient Utilization The superior ingredients in quality pet food contribute to improved digestion and enhanced nutrient absorption. This not only aids in preventing gastrointestinal issues but also ensures that your pet maximizes the benefits from each meal.
-
Skin and Coat Health A diet rich in quality ingredients, such as Omega-3 fatty acids and antioxidants, plays a pivotal role in maintaining healthy skin and a lustrous coat. Beyond aesthetics, a well-nourished skin and coat are indicative of your pet's internal well-being.
-
Weight Management and Muscle Health Precisely portioned high-quality pet food helps in managing your pet's weight effectively, reducing the risk of obesity-related concerns. Additionally, the protein content supports muscle development, contributing to a lean and healthy physique.
-
Vitality and Longevity By feeding your pet quality food devoid of fillers and artificial additives, you are safeguarding their long-term health and vitality. A nutritious diet not only enhances their energy levels and immune system but also promotes a longer, happier life.
-
Mental Stimulation and Behavioral Benefits High-quality pet food can also impact your pet's mental acuity and behavior. Certain ingredients like omega fatty acids and antioxidants support cognitive function, promoting alertness and overall mental well-being.

Beyond the physical benefits, quality pet food can also address specific dietary needs. Specialized formulations cater to pets with allergies, sensitivities, or age-related conditions. For instance, grain-free options are available for pets with gluten intolerances, while senior pet diets focus on joint health and easy digestion.
Moreover, the quality of ingredients in pet food directly impacts the overall taste and palatability. High-quality recipes often use real meat, wholesome grains, and natural flavors, enticing even the pickiest eaters. This not only ensures that your pet enjoys mealtime but also encourages consistent and healthy eating habits.

Strategies for Pet Food Retailers
Pet owners are always on the lookout for the best deals when it comes to purchasing food for their beloved furry friends. As a pet food retailer, implementing well-thought-out discount strategies can not only attract new customers but also retain existing ones. One effective approach is to introduce tiered discounts based on the quantity of pet food purchased. By offering discounts for bulk purchases, retailers can entice customers to buy more in a single transaction, thereby increasing the average order value.
Loyalty Programs
In addition to quantity-based discounts, loyalty programs can be a valuable tool for building customer loyalty. Through these programs, customers can earn points with each purchase, which can later be redeemed for discounts on future transactions. This not only encourages repeat business but also fosters a sense of appreciation among customers for their continued support.
Flash Sales and Limited-Time Promotions
To further drive customer engagement, retailers can periodically introduce flash sales or limited-time promotions. These time-sensitive offers create a sense of urgency, prompting customers to make quicker purchasing decisions. Such promotions not only boost sales during the promotion period but also help in clearing out excess inventory or introducing new products to the market.
Profit Margin Analysis
While discounts and promotions are effective in attracting customers, it's essential for retailers to carefully monitor their profit margins. Analyzing the impact of discounts on profitability is crucial to ensure that the pricing strategies remain sustainable in the long run. It may be necessary to adjust pricing or discount levels based on the analysis to strike a balance between customer satisfaction and business profitability.

Strategies to Save Money on Pet Food
When it comes to caring for our beloved pets, providing them with high-quality nutrition is essential. However, the costs of pet food can add up over time. Luckily, there are several strategies that pet owners can use to save money on their pet food purchases. One effective way is to take advantage of bulk purchase discounts offered by pet product retailers. By buying larger quantities of pet food, litter, or other supplies, pet owners can benefit from reduced prices per unit.
In addition to bulk discounts, pet owners can also look for manufacturer coupons that offer discounts on specific brands or products. These coupons can usually be found on the manufacturer's website, in pet store flyers, or in pet-related magazines. By using these coupons during their purchases, pet owners can save a significant amount of money.
Another money-saving strategy is to enroll in loyalty programs offered by pet stores. These programs often provide members with exclusive discounts, special offers, or rewards points that can be redeemed for future purchases. By being a part of such programs, pet owners can enjoy additional savings on their pet food expenses.
Furthermore, many online retailers offer subscribe-and-save options for pet food purchases. By subscribing to regular deliveries of pet food, pet owners can not only save money on each purchase but also ensure that they never run out of essential supplies for their pets. This hassle-free option not only saves money but also saves time and effort.
Additionally, pet owners should consider comparing prices across different retailers to ensure they are getting the best deals. Sometimes, the same product can vary in price between stores, and by doing a quick comparison, pet owners can save even more.
It's also beneficial to keep an eye out for seasonal sales and promotions. During certain times of the year, pet stores may offer discounts on specific products or brands, allowing pet owners to stock up on pet food at lower prices.
Another tip is to consider making homemade pet treats or food. With some research and guidance from a vet, pet owners can create nutritious meals or treats for their pets, potentially saving money in the long run.
Moreover, staying informed about pet food recalls and staying loyal to trusted brands can help prevent unnecessary expenses caused by poor-quality products.

Guide to Selecting Discounted Pet Food
When it comes to choosing discounted pet food, pet owners have a responsibility to ensure that they are making informed decisions that prioritize the health and well-being of their furry companions. In this guide to best practices for selecting discounted pet food, we will delve into essential considerations that pet owners should keep in mind to maintain the quality of the food while taking advantage of cost savings.
Expiration Dates
One of the primary factors to consider is checking the expiration dates of discounted pet food products. Ensuring that the food has not exceeded its expiration date is crucial to guarantee its freshness and nutritional value. Consuming expired pet food can be harmful to pets and may lead to health issues, so pet owners must be vigilant when inspecting expiration dates.
Ingredients Quality
In addition to expiration dates, pet owners should carefully examine the ingredients listed on the packaging. Opting for pet food that contains high-quality, wholesome ingredients is essential for supporting your pet's overall health and well-being. By understanding the ingredients and their nutritional benefits, pet owners can make informed choices that align with their pet's dietary requirements.
Brand Reputation
Moreover, it is advisable for pet owners to verify the reputation of the brand offering discounted pet food. Choosing products from reputable brands with a history of providing nutritious and safe pet food products can offer peace of mind regarding the quality and safety of the food being purchased.
